About the role
- Review contracts, statements of work, and internal initiatives to extract and structure defined deliverables, work types, milestones, timelines, and dependencies.
- Ensure all contracted work is accurately set up in operational tracking systems (Notion, Monday.com, TMetric, and related tools).
- Partner with Operations leadership and Technical Team Leads to validate scope, assumptions, and tracking requirements prior to execution.
- Prepare projects for handoff by establishing clear structure, documentation, and tracking expectations.
- Develop and maintain project structures, tracking dashboards, and reporting views that provide visibility into scope, timeline, and progress.
- Hand off structured projects to Technical Team Leads, who retain ownership of execution, technical decisions, and delivery.
- Maintain project documentation, timelines, and status updates for internal visibility.
- Coordinate internal project meetings as needed to support alignment and clarity.
- Track personnel assignments and time allocation across projects for visibility into resource usage.
- Identify capacity constraints, over-allocation, and upcoming staffing needs.
- Support coordination of shared resources across teams as needed.
- Monitor burn versus scope to help identify delivery risks.
- Develop and document standardized project intake, setup, and tracking processes.
- Promote consistent project management practices while respecting Technical Team Leads’ ownership.
- Track project progress against scope, timelines, and burn rate using established tools.
- Prepare internal status reports and summaries for Operations and Leadership.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field (e.g., biology, bioinformatics, public health, project management, or related discipline).
- 3–5+ years of experience in operations-focused project or program management roles.
- Experience translating scoped or contracted work into structured tracking systems.
- Excellent organizational, problem-solving, and communication skills.
- Ability to coordinate diverse teams and manage multiple concurrent projects in a fast-paced environment.
- Experience with project and work-tracking tools (*e.g.*, Notion, Monday.com, TMetric, Smartsheet, Asana, Jira).
- Master’s degree or PMP/Prince2 certification (Preferred).
- Experience in genomics, bioinformatics, or public health data projects (Preferred).
- Familiarity with government or academic project processes (e.g., CDC, NIH, or state health departments) (Preferred).
